Default no brake or turn signal

Hey guys
Anyone out there familiar with electronics with the wiring from front to back on the tail lights. My rt rear brake and turnsignal won't work. I've tried a different bulb, and tested the wires at the back of the taillight housing. Running lights are ok on both sides. Someone told me it was the flasher unit,,,but why would my left turnsignal and brake light work??? Are there seperate flashers?
Any help would be appreciated.

its not your flasher, check the grounds, also, maybe try plugging in the right side housings (one at a time) to the opposite side of the car that does work, this might show you that theres something wrong with one of them,.,...if they both work, it's your wiring that is going bad on one or both of the units on your right side.

Probably not your problem since one side does work but I had a similar problem with my 68 except that several of my lights weren't working. After a few works of trying everything else I discovered my fuse box had formed a layer of surface rust where the fuses snap into. After I took a very small piece of sandpaper and removed the rust from all the holders, magicly everything worked like a charm. Hopefully your problem is something simple also. Like was already mentioned check the ground near the fuel filler neck inside the trunk (at least that's where mine is on my 68).
